Your Responsibilities

  • Review tax workpapers & draft tax returns from third-party preparers
  • Review quarterly & annual REIT testing workpapers and supporting documentation
  • Assist with data collection and review for acquisitions and dispositions
  • Maintain tax log of filings and payments
  • Coordinate receipt of tax returns with third-party preparers and ensure timely filing
  • Review payment calculations for various tax filings to multiple jurisdictions
  • Collaborate with other departments (Accounting, FP&A, Capital)
  • Review quarterly depreciation
  • Provide annual investor taxable income estimates
  • Respond to investor questions
  • Monitor and respond to tax notices
  • Maintain real estate tax data in software
  • Manage and mentor members of tax team
